Types of Stone Masonry Projects

Stonemasonry is often divided into two main categories: stone masonry work and stone masonry repair. Stonemasonry work commonly includes building walls, sliding, chimneys, patios, and walkways. Stonemasonry repair is often fixing cracks, rebuilding structurally compromised structures, and replacing mortar.

Below are some types of stone masonry work:

  • Interior stone walls. Traditionally, installing stone walls is quite expensive. To avoid this, homeowners can use veneered stone walls for the interior, as a less expensive option. It costs less because veneered stones are thin blocks that can be manufactured or sourced naturally. The thin blocks are only for the outward appearance—the rest of the wall is comprised of concrete. This is a great way to create accent walls for a vintage aesthetic.
  • Exterior stone walls. These walls are often costlier because mortared stones are often the best material for exterior stone wall projects. This is because mortared stones are less susceptible to moisture penetrating the cracks, which damages the stones over time. While it is costlier, exterior stone walls are durable, which makes them valuable. If you want to consider a veneered wall for your exterior instead, just ask your contractor if it is possible.
  • Stone siding. Stone siding on the exterior of your home creates a luxury aesthetic, which often raises the property value. Stone siding looks more expensive because it used to be a costly option. Now, instead of manufacturing only from real stone and flagstone, veneer products can be used on the exterior of the home for decorative purposes.
  • Chimneys and fireplaces. Fireplaces can be installed for aesthetics as well as functionality. Well-crafted fireplaces can serve as the center of the home, as they are a strong design statement. Because of this, stone fireplaces are worth the investment.
  • Patios and walkways. Stone walkways are an easy way to transform your landscaping in one step. This raises the curb appeal of your home, and can even raise its overall value.
